POSITION SUMMARY
  • This role is responsible for supporting thermal equipment sales in assigned Vertiv local offices (FDOs/LVOs) and specific national accounts. This support primarily consists of customer presentations, leading specific sales opportunities, and delivery of technical training.


RESPONSIBILITIES
  • Support local offices and national customers in design discussions to establish Vertiv as basis of design.
  • Maintain consistent relationships with key engineering firms within assigned territory and track Vertiv performance.
  • Consistently evaluate and improve the technical selling competency in local sales offices through ongoing thermal systems training.
  • Actively participating in customer visits through presentations and entertainment.
  • Participate as needed in account planning efforts and engagement strategies for key clients.
  • Represent Vertiv at industry conferences, seminars, and customer presentations.
  • Stay updated on evolving industry trends, materials, and technologies to maintain Vertiv's competitive edge.
  • Provide industry feedback to product managers for product improvements and roadmaps.
  • Provide escalation support for customer requests not addressable by local sales teams.
  • Mentor early career Vertiv employees within technical sales team.


QUALIFICATIONS
  • 10-12 years of chilled water industry technical experience with sales experience preferred.
  • Technical knowledge of HVAC and mechanical building systems and applications.
  • Deep market dynamics and industry knowledge.
  • Proven track record of influencing engineering accounts.
  • Experience working with sales offices.
  • Salesmanship and self-confidence to deal with stressful customer relationship issues.
  • Excellent sales presentation skills.
  • Strong problem-solving skills and ability to translate technical challenges into actionable plans.
  • Bachelor's degree in engineering, business, or related field of study (or equivalent combination of education and experience).


PHYSICAL & ENVIRONMENTAL DEMANDS
  • No special physical requirements.


TIME TRAVEL REQUIRED
  • 30-50%.

About Vertiv Holdings Co.

Vertiv Holdings Co. is a global provider of critical digital infrastructure and continuity solutions. The company offers a broad range of products and services, including power management, thermal management, and IT infrastructure management. Vertiv serves customers in a variety of industries, including telecommunications, healthcare, and financial services. The company was founded in 2016 and is headquartered in Columbus, Ohio.
